From 287d0fd9fd873b5913fa76ae500d17dfa3e9b705 Mon Sep 17 00:00:00 2001 From: Derek Nance Date: Wed, 14 Jan 2026 09:19:45 -0600 Subject: [PATCH] revert preload base --- apps/desktop/src/preload.base.ts | 13 ------------- apps/desktop/src/preload.ts | 14 ++++++++++++-- bitwarden_license/bit-desktop/src/preload.ts | 4 ++-- 3 files changed, 14 insertions(+), 17 deletions(-) delete mode 100644 apps/desktop/src/preload.base.ts diff --git a/apps/desktop/src/preload.base.ts b/apps/desktop/src/preload.base.ts deleted file mode 100644 index 94688d035ce..00000000000 --- a/apps/desktop/src/preload.base.ts +++ /dev/null @@ -1,13 +0,0 @@ -import tools from "./app/tools/preload"; -import auth from "./auth/preload"; -import autofill from "./autofill/preload"; -import keyManagement from "./key-management/preload"; -import platform from "./platform/preload"; - -export const ipc = { - auth, - autofill, - platform, - keyManagement, - tools, -} as const; diff --git a/apps/desktop/src/preload.ts b/apps/desktop/src/preload.ts index f81bc7fbb98..a786885c1b8 100644 --- a/apps/desktop/src/preload.ts +++ b/apps/desktop/src/preload.ts @@ -1,6 +1,10 @@ import { contextBridge } from "electron"; -import { ipc } from "./preload.base"; +import tools from "./app/tools/preload"; +import auth from "./auth/preload"; +import autofill from "./autofill/preload"; +import keyManagement from "./key-management/preload"; +import platform from "./platform/preload"; /** * Bitwarden Preload script. @@ -13,6 +17,12 @@ import { ipc } from "./preload.base"; */ // Each team owns a subspace of the `ipc` global variable in the renderer. -export { ipc }; +export const ipc = { + auth, + autofill, + platform, + keyManagement, + tools, +} as const; contextBridge.exposeInMainWorld("ipc", ipc); diff --git a/bitwarden_license/bit-desktop/src/preload.ts b/bitwarden_license/bit-desktop/src/preload.ts index 3407ce46219..4034527179b 100644 --- a/bitwarden_license/bit-desktop/src/preload.ts +++ b/bitwarden_license/bit-desktop/src/preload.ts @@ -1,6 +1,6 @@ import { contextBridge } from "electron"; -import { ipc as ossIpc } from "@bitwarden/desktop/preload.base"; +import { ipc as ossIpc } from "@bitwarden/desktop/preload"; /** * Bitwarden Preload script. @@ -12,6 +12,6 @@ import { ipc as ossIpc } from "@bitwarden/desktop/preload.base"; export const ipc = { ...ossIpc, -}; +} as const; contextBridge.exposeInMainWorld("ipc", ipc);